b"This week on From the Front Porch, Annie is joined by her mom, Susie to discuss books for sensitive readers.\\nThe books mentioned in this week\\u2019s episode can be purchased from The Bookshelf:\\n\\nWhat Comes After by Joanne Tompkins\\n\\n\\nThe Sweet Taste of Muscadines by Pamela Terry\\n\\n\\nThe Incredible Winston Browne by Sean Dietrich\\xa0\\n\\n\\nThe Personal Librarian by Marie Benedict, Victoria Christopher Murray\\xa0\\n\\n\\nThink Like a Monk by Jay Shetty\\n\\n\\nThe Practice of the Presence of God by Brother Lawrence\\n\\n\\nGod Spare the Girls by Kelsey McKinney\\n\\n\\nWhen Ghosts Come Home by Wiley Cash\\n\\n\\nVery Sincerely Yours by Kerry Winfrey\\n\\n\\nRock the Boat by Beck Dorey-Stein\\n\\nFrom the Front Porch is a weekly podcast production of The Bookshelf, an independent bookstore in South Georgia.
